Woman stabs man over stable bed

KOTA KINABALU: Fighting over a place to sleep landed a man in hospital after he was stabbed in the back by a woman, believed to be mentally unstable, at a horse stable in Tanjung Aru.

The incident happened when the 52-year-old victim apparently scolded the woman for sleeping on his “bed” around 3.30am on Wednesday.

Both the man and woman then started arguing over the bed which caused the latter to pull out a folded knife, about 14.5 cm long, and stabbed the man on the back.

Following a police report lodged by the victim, the police managed to arrest the suspect around 5.20am on Thursday.

“Police detained the woman the following morning at the horse stable in Tanjung Aru.

“The suspect did not resist arrest and police also seized the folded knife that was believed used by the suspect in the incident,” said city police chief ACP M. Chandra yesterday.

The victim is currently in stable condition after seeking treatment at the Queen Elizabeth Hospital.

Chandra said initial investigation believed that both the victim and suspect were friends and both were believed to be high after sniffing glue when the incident happened.

The case is being investigated under Section 324 of the Penal Code for causing injury.
